Unraveling the Essence of Keywords

Before we delve into the intricacies of keyword research, let's establish a solid grasp of what keywords are and why they hold paramount importance in the digital landscape.

Keywords are the building blocks of online searches; they are the words or phrases that users input into search engines when seeking information, products, or services. Think of them as the secret passageways that connect users to the content they desire. Proficient keyword research equates to understanding your audience's language, enabling you to tailor your content precisely to their needs and preferences.

The Crucial Role of Keyword Research

Keyword research isn't just a checkbox on your SEO to-do list; it forms the bedrock upon which your entire digital presence rests. Here are compelling reasons why keyword research is indispensable:

1. Precision in Targeting

Effective keyword research empowers you to pinpoint the exact terms and phrases that potential visitors are using to search for content or products within your niche. By optimizing your content for these keywords, you attract a highly targeted audience genuinely interested in what you offer.

2. Competitive Advantage

In the digital realm, your competitors are just a click away. Keyword research allows you to uncover gaps in their strategies and seize untapped opportunities. This competitive advantage can be a game-changer in the cutthroat world of online marketing.

3. Relevance Reigns Supreme

Using the right keywords ensures that your content aligns with user queries. Search engines reward relevance with higher rankings, which can significantly amplify your organic traffic.

4. ROI Amplification

Investing time in meticulous keyword research prevents you from targeting overly competitive keywords or those that don't align with your objectives. This, in turn, maximizes your Return on Investment (ROI) by focusing your efforts where they matter most.

A Step-by-Step Expedition into Effective Keyword Research

Now that we've cemented the importance of keyword research, let's embark on a comprehensive journey through the step-by-step process of conducting it effectively.

Step 1: Define Your Objectives

Begin by crystalizing your goals. Do you aim to boost website traffic, increase sales, or enhance brand visibility? Your objectives will shape the types of keywords you target.

Step 2: Brainstorm Seed Keywords

Commence with a list of seed keywords—these are broad terms closely related to your niche. Seed keywords serve as the foundation for your research.

For instance, if you're in the fitness industry, your seed keywords could include "weight loss," "muscle building," and "nutrition."

Step 3: Expand Your Keyword Repository

Harness the power of keyword research tools to expand your list. Popular tools like Google Keyword Planner, Ahrefs, and SEMrush provide invaluable insights into search volume, competition, and related keywords.

For example, if you're targeting the seed keyword "weight loss," these tools can unveil related keywords like "weight loss diet plans," "best exercises for weight loss," and "weight loss supplements."

Step 4: Analyze Competitor Keywords

Strategically examine the keywords your competitors are targeting. This can unveil valuable opportunities and reveal gaps in your strategy. Tools like SpyFu and Moz can assist in competitor keyword analysis.

Let's say your competitor in the fitness industry is ranking well for "effective weight loss workouts." You might consider creating content optimized for similar keywords.

Step 5: Gauge Keyword Relevance

Not all keywords are created equal. Evaluate the relevance of each keyword to your content and target audience. Prioritize long-tail keywords for more specific targeting.

For instance, if your website is about healthy recipes, "quick and easy vegetarian dinner recipes" is a highly relevant long-tail keyword to consider.

Step 6: Estimate Keyword Difficulty

Ascertain the difficulty of ranking for each keyword. Striking a balance between high-competition and low-competition keywords is pivotal for success. Tools like Ahrefs and Moz provide keyword difficulty scores.

If you find that "best smartphone" is overly competitive, you might opt for a less competitive alternative like "top budget smartphones under $500."

Step 7: Craft High-Quality Content

Once you've identified your target keywords, it's time to craft compelling content that offers real value to your audience. Search engines favor informative, well-researched, and engaging content that genuinely serves the needs of users.

Suppose you're targeting the keyword "healthy breakfast recipes." In that case, your content should feature a variety of nutritious breakfast ideas, complete with detailed instructions and nutritional information.

Step 8: Monitor and Adapt

SEO is a dynamic discipline. Regularly monitor your rankings and be ready to adjust your strategy as needed. Keep a vigilant eye on emerging trends and evolving user behavior to stay ahead of the curve.
